Transaction 58bd0f3b33c99b588d4867f048054137532b126abcd2fb56f33e974149537bba
2 Input
2 Outputs
- 58bd0f3b33c99b588d4867f048054137532b126abcd2fb56f33e974149537bba:0
- 58bd0f3b33c99b588d4867f048054137532b126abcd2fb56f33e974149537bba:1
value 10000
address 15qeYXZEk8dwgJUJn8r14MEXcHbNtJP4h9
value 37489
address 14m3vVDpZpwC8aDk2hNwpn5pUsZJiHWSn7